The word can be confusing, so let us start plainly. A cuckquean is a woman who finds erotic or emotional satisfaction connected to her partner being sexually or romantically involved with another woman, with everyone's knowledge and agreement. It is the feminine counterpart to the much better known cuckold dynamic. And while the male version has drifted into the cultural mainstream, the female one has stayed in the shadows, which is most of why it feels so lonely to the people who discover it in themselves.
Consent is what separates it from betrayal
Everything rests on one word: consent, meaning enthusiastic, informed, ongoing, and freely revocable by anyone at any time. Without it, this is not the cuckquean lifestyle at all. It is just cheating. With it, the dynamic becomes something built together, deliberately, that either person can pause or stop whenever they need to. If you remember one thing, remember that the freedom to stop is exactly what makes it safe to begin.
It is a spectrum, not a single act
People imagine one dramatic scene, but in practice this is a wide spectrum. On the gentle end it lives entirely in fantasy and conversation and never involves anyone else, which is a complete and happy destination for many couples. In the middle are degrees of real involvement. You get to choose your point on the spectrum, move along it slowly, and move back whenever you like. Staying in fantasy forever is not failing at anything.
What it is not
It is not self-hatred dressed up as a kink, and it is not a sign that a woman does not value herself. For most people who feel it, the psychology runs the other way. It tends to come from security, trust, and a generous pleasure in a partner's pleasure, a feeling that even has a name, compersion. It is also not simply the cuckold dynamic reversed. Its emotional flavor is usually tenderer and warmer than the humiliation-heavy version the internet led you to expect.
